Electric push button water temperature and flow volume control console
Abstract
A water control device. The device generally includes a casing having a top panel, bottom panel, and sidewalls defining an enclosure. An electrical circuit disposed in the enclosure. One or more electrical push buttons are coupled to the top panel, each push button being electrically coupled to the electric circuit. Electrical wiring electronically couples the electric circuit to one or more valves controlling the flow of cold water and hot water to a water faucet. An electrical power cable couples the electrical circuit to an electrical power source, wherein each electrical push button is assigned to a different desired temperature and flow rate, and wherein each electrical push button may be engaged to change the desired temperature and flow volume rate of water flowing from the water faucet.

1 . A water control device, the device comprising:
a casing having a top panel, bottom panel, and sidewalls defining an enclosure; an electrical circuit disposed in the enclosure; a plurality of electrical push button coupled to the top panel, each push button being electrically coupled to the electric circuit; electrical wiring electronically coupling the electric circuit to one or more valves controlling the flow of cold water and hot water to a water faucet; and an electrical power cable coupling the electrical circuit to an electrical power source; wherein each electrical push button is assigned to a different desired temperature and flow rate; and wherein each electrical push button may be engaged to change the desired temperature and flow volume rate of water flowing from the water faucet.
2 . A method of controlling the temperature and flow of water from a faucet, the method comprising:
